What may be hiding behind the closed doors of a house?
What is the true relationship of family members?
How do people face their fellow human beings who have disabilities? What is right and what is wrong?
In the early ' 70, Zoe, looks after her son Stavros who was born with mental retardation in an era without social support and possibilities of integration and special education.
